Football / Re: T&T finishes second in Group C
« on: September 09, 2016, 07:25:10 AM »
I watched the game again and you know what really bothers me is Hart played the right formation; a 4231 with a double pivot defensive mid. This would have provided enough defensive cover had the full backs and wingers played to the instructions which I am sure he gave (as they did so for the first half hr)

This formation has strengths in the middle, the flanks would be the area for them to exploit. If the wingers are high (Jovein, Levi where pressing all game), movements from the opposition winger moving off their full back to receive the ball can be exploited and  therefore requires understanding from the wide players to close the space between him and his full back. Aubrey and Mikel were doing that for the first half but for some reason come the second half they just stopped (simple one twos were working to open space). Of course assistance from the wide players in getting back to close the space would have helped as well.

I also noticed Hyland pushed way up the field in the second half so only Boucaud (later George) was left back. We then started to see alot more penetration through the middle.

It looks like we lost discipline all over the park. I can understand Harts frustration and anger after the game at the senior players who clearly didn't follow instructions...
